Two-Day Wayanad Adventure Itinerary in May 2023

  1. Day 1: Chembra Peak
    1 hour 15 minutes (20 miles) from Kalpetta

    Start your adventure with a trek to the Chembra Peak, the highest peak in Wayanad. It takes about four hours to reach the summit, but the stunning views of the heart-shaped lake make it worth the effort. Remember to obtain a permit from the Meppadi forest office before you start the trek. After descending the peak, cool off with a refreshing swim at Soochipara Waterfalls, located 1 hour 30 minutes (22 miles) southeast of Chembra Peak.

  2. Day 2: Banasura Sagar Dam
    1 hour 30 minutes (33 miles) from Kalpetta

    On your second day, visit the Banasura Sagar Dam, an earthen dam formed by the Banasura Sagar reservoir. You can enjoy a range of activities here, including speed boating, kayaking, and zip-lining. Afterward, head to the Edakkal Caves, located 1 hour 10 minutes (22 miles) northeast of the dam. The caves are famous for their prehistoric rock engravings, and the hike to reach them is an adventure in itself.

Useful Tips

If you have more time, you can add a trip to the Tholpetty Wildlife Sanctuary, which is 1 hour 20 minutes (31 miles) north of Kalpetta and home to tigers, leopards, and elephants. Alternatively, if you have less time, you can skip the Soochipara Waterfalls or the Banasura Sagar Dam activities, depending on your preferences.
